SMEDT v. HAIN CELESTIAL GROUP, INC.

Case No. 5:12-CV-03029-EJD.

SUZANNE SMEDT, individually and on behalf of all others similarly situated, Plaintiff, v. THE HAIN CELESTIAL GROUP, INC., Defendant.

United States District Court, N.D. California, San Jose Division.

May 30, 2014.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Suzanne Smedt, individually and on behalf of all others similarly situated, Plaintiff, represented by Ben F. Pierce Gore , Pratt & Associates & Charles F. Barrett , Charles Barrett, P.C..

The Hain Celestial Group, Inc., Defendant, represented by William Lewis Stern , Morrison & Foerster LLP.


ORDER GRANTING MOTION TO PARTIALLY DISMISS

[Re: Docket No. 55]

EDWARD J. DAVILA, District Judge.

Presently before the Court is Defendant The Hain Celestial Group, Inc.'s ("Defendant" or "Hain") Motion to Dismiss Plaintiff Suzanne Smedt's Second Amended Complaint ("SAC"). Plaintiff filed this putative class action against Defendant alleging that several of Defendant's products have been improperly labeled so as to amount to misbranding and deception...
